Hypericaceae: Characters, Regions & Art

Hypericaceae is a plant family in the order Malpighiales, comprising six to nine genera and up to 700 species, and commonly known as the St. John's wort family. Members are found throughout the world apart from extremely cold or dry habitats. Hypericum and Triadenum occur in temperate regions but other genera are mostly tropical.
